Course Details
• Health Care Systems and Policy: An in-depth analysis of various health care systems, policies, and reforms shaping integrated health care planning.
• Epidemiology and Public Health: A comprehensive exploration of epidemiological concepts, principles, and methods in public health.
• Clinical Informatics and Data Analytics: The use of technology, data, and information systems to improve health care delivery and decision-making in integrated care settings.
• Integrated Care Models and Approaches: An examination of various integrated care models and their application in diverse health care settings.
• Patient-Centered Care and Collaborative Practice: The role of patient-centered care and interprofessional collaboration in improving health outcomes and reducing costs.
• Health Economics and Financial Management: An understanding of health economics principles and financial management strategies in integrated care planning.
• Leadership and Change Management: Developing leadership and change management skills to drive innovation and improvement in integrated care settings.
• Quality Improvement and Performance Metrics: Implementing quality improvement strategies and measuring performance metrics in integrated health care planning.
